... Read moreBecoming a plant parent is an exciting journey that allows you to connect with nature and beautify your living space. Starting with hardy plants like Pothos is ideal for beginners. These resilient plants thrive in a variety of conditions and only need to be watered about once a week, making them perfect for those new to plant care. When selecting your plants, consider factors such as light levels in your home, as some plants require more sunlight than others. For Pothos, indirect sunlight is best, allowing the vine to flourish. Additionally, it's crucial to educate yourself on the specific needs of each plant. For instance, understanding when to re-pot or how to propagate your plants can significantly enhance their growth and lifespan. Joining plant communities, such as online forums or local gardening clubs, can provide you with support and inspiration. Sharing your experiences with others can help you gain valuable insights and foster a sense of belonging among fellow plant enthusiasts. Not only does gardening offer therapeutic benefits, but it also contributes positively to your environment by improving air quality. With time, patience, and passion, you can cultivate a beautiful indoor garden that brings joy to your everyday life.
